### ACM题目分类详解 #### 一、概述 ACM题目分类是帮助参赛者更好地准备比赛、提高编程技能的重要工具。通过将题目按照不同算法和技术进行分类,可以帮助学习者有针对性地练习,避免盲目刷题,从而更高效地提升解题能力。 #### 二、题目分类详解 **1. 大数类** - **1002**: 大数运算的基础题,可能涉及到加减乘除等基本操作。 - **1041**: 需要用到大数处理的题目,可能是乘方或阶乘等问题。 - **1077**: 大数处理相关的题目,具体细节未提及。 - **100210041013101510171020102210291031103310341035103610371039**: 这些题目均涉及大数处理,但具体细节未知。 **2. DP (动态规划) 类** - **1003**: 最大连续子段和问题,是DP的经典案例。 - **1024**: 最大子段和问题的变种,通常需要使用DP来解决。 - **1025**: 最长递增子序列问题,可以通过DP结合二分查找实现NlogN的时间复杂度。 - **1051**: 可以用贪心或者DP来解决的问题。 - **1058**: 关于丑数的经典DP问题。 - **1059**: 涉及DP的整数拆分问题,需要注意优化以防止超时。 - **1069**: 经典的DP问题,具体细节未给出。 - **1074**: DP问题,具体细节未知。 - **1078**: DP问题,可能与博弈有关。 - **1080**: DP问题,具体细节未知。 - **1081**: 经典DP问题,具体细节未知。 - **1085**: 涉及母函数的DP问题,需要特别注意优化。 - **1087**: 简单的DP问题。 - **11141158115911601171117611811203122412271231124412481253125412831300**: 这些题目都属于DP类别,但具体的细节未知。 **3. 字符串处理类** - **1019**: 基础的字符串处理题目,可能涉及到模式匹配或者字符替换等操作。 - **1039**: 字符串处理题目,需要特别注意处理大数。 - **1049**: 字符串处理基础题。 - **1088**: 简单的字符串处理题目。 - **1089~1096**: 这8个题目都是练习输入输出的题目,具体细节未知。 **4. 贪心算法类** - **1009**: 贪心算法的基本应用题。 - **1050**: 贪心算法题,具体细节未知。 - **1052**: 贪心算法题,可能涉及到数组或排序等问题。 - **1053**: 关于Huffman编码的贪心问题。 - **1055**: 二分匹配问题,也可能涉及贪心思想。 - **1090~1096**: 输入输出练习题,具体细节未知。 - **1055**: 二分匹配题,也可能涉及贪心算法。 - **1052**: 贪心算法题。 **5. 数学类** - **1005**: 找规律的题目,可能与数列或周期性有关。 - **1012**: 简单数学题,可能涉及到基本的算术操作。 - **1014**: 简单数学题。 - **1018**: 简单数学题,可能与数列或代数公式有关。 - **1019**: 数学题,可能需要用到特定的数学知识如组合数学。 - **1021**: 数学题,需要找到规律才能解决。 - **1023**: 关于Catalan Number的题目,这是一种在组合数学中常见的数列。 - **1027**: 数学题,可能涉及到代数或者几何知识。 - **1060**: 数学题,需要使用大数处理。 - **1061**: 数学题,具体细节未知。 - **1071**: 简单的数学题。 - **1097**: 简单数学题。 - **1098**: 数学题,需要注意找到规律。 - **1099**: 数学题,可能涉及到模拟题或者枚举法解决问题。 - **1100**: 数学题,具体细节未知。 - **1108**: 数学题,具体细节未知。 - **1110**: 数学题,具体细节未知。 - **1112**: 数学题,具体细节未知。 - **1124**: 数学题,具体细节未知。 - **1130**: 数学题,具体细节未知。 - **1131**: 数学题,具体细节未知。 - **1132**: 数学题,具体细节未知。 - **1134**: 数学题,具体细节未知。 - **1141**: 数学题,具体细节未知。 - **1143**: 数学题,具体细节未知。 - **1152**: 数学题,具体细节未知。 - **1155**: 物理题,可能涉及到力学等概念。 - **1163**: 数学题,具体细节未知。 - **1165**: 数学题,具体细节未知。 - **1178**: 数学题,具体细节未知。 - **1194**: 数学题,具体细节未知。 - **1196**: 数学题,可能与lowbit技巧有关。 - **1210**: 数学题,具体细节未知。 - **1214**: 数学题,具体细节未知。 - **1221**: 数学题,具体细节未知。 - **1223**: 数学题,具体细节未知。 - **1249**: 数学题,具体细节未知。 - **1261**: 数学题,具体细节未知。 - **1267**: 数学题,具体细节未知。 - **1273**: 数学题,具体细节未知。 - **1290**: 数学题,具体细节未知。 - **1291**: 数学题,具体细节未知。 - **1292**: 数学题,具体细节未知。 - **1294**: 数学题,具体细节未知。 - **1297**: 数学题,具体细节未知。 - **1313**: 数学题,具体细节未知。 - **1316**: 数学题,具体细节未知。 **6. 博弈类** - **1079**: 与博弈相关的DP问题。 - **1081**: 博弈问题,可能涉及到DP技术。 **7. 搜索类** - **1010**: 搜索题,需要注意剪枝以提高效率。 - **1016**: 经典的搜索题。 - **1033**: 模拟题,可能涉及到状态模拟或图的遍历。 - **1034**: Candy Sharing Game,具体细节未知。 - **1035**: 模拟题,可能涉及到状态模拟或图的遍历。 - **1037**: 简单题,非一般的简单,具体细节未知。 - **1043**: 双广搜索题,可能涉及到BFS和DFS结合使用。 - **1044**: BFS和DFS结合使用的题目。 - **1045**: 搜索题,可能涉及到匹配算法。 - **1067**: 具体细节未知。 - **1072**: 搜索题,具体细节未知。 - **1104**: 搜索题,具体细节未知。 - **1175**: 搜索题,具体细节未知。 - **1180**: 搜索题,具体细节未知。 - **1195**: 搜索题,具体细节未知。 - **1208**: 搜索题,具体细节未知。 - **1226**: 搜索题,具体细节未知。 - **1238**: 搜索题,具体细节未知。 - **1240**: 搜索题,具体细节未知。 - **1241**: 搜索题,具体细节未知。 - **1242**: 搜索题,具体细节未知。 - **1258**: 搜索题,具体细节未知。 - **1271**: 搜索题,具体细节未知。 - **1312**: 搜索题,具体细节未知。 **8. 数据结构类** - **1022**: 数据结构题,涉及到栈的应用。 - **1040**: 简单排序题。 - **1047**: 大数处理题。 - **1075**: 字典树相关题目。 - **1212**: 大数取模问题,具体细节未知。 - **1216**: 链表相关题目,具体细节未知。 - **1218**: 数据结构题,具体细节未知。 - **1219**: 数据结构题,具体细节未知。 - **1225**: 数据结构题,具体细节未知。 - **1228**: 数据结构题,具体细节未知。 - **1229**: 数据结构题,具体细节未知。 - **1230**: 数据结构题,具体细节未知。 - **1234**: 数据结构题,具体细节未知。 - **1235**: 数据结构题,具体细节未知。 - **1236**: 数据结构题,具体细节未知。 - **1237**: 数据结构题,具体细节未知。 - **1239**: 数据结构题,具体细节未知。 - **1250**: 数据结构题,具体细节未知。 **9. 二分匹配类** - **1044**: BFS与DFS结合使用的搜索题。 - **1054**: 二分匹配题。 - **1055**: 二分匹配题。 - **1068**: 经典的二分匹配题。 - **1083**: 二分匹配题。 - **1106**: 二分匹配题。 - **1144**: 二分匹配题。 - **1244**: 二分匹配题。 **10. 计算几何类** - **1086**: 简单的几何题。 - **1115**: 几何题,具体细节未知。 - **1147**: 几何题,具体细节未知。 **11. 数论类** - **1164**: 数论题,具体细节未知。 - **1211**: 数论题,具体细节未知。 - **1215**: 数论题,具体细节未知。 - **1222**: 数论题,具体细节未知。 - **1286**: 数论题,具体细节未知。 - **1299**: 数论题,具体细节未知。 **12. 其他类** - **1001**: 基础题,具体细节未知。 - **1004**: 简单题,具体细节未知。 - **1006**: 难度较高的题目,作者至今未能通过。 - **1007**: 使用分治法的经典问题,最近点对问题。 - **1008**: 简单题,具体细节未知。 - **1011**: 简单题,具体细节未知。 - **1012**: 简单题,具体细节未知。 - **1013**: 简单题,需考虑大数。 - **1014**: 简单题,具体细节未知。 - **1015**: 搜索题,具体细节未知。 - **1020**: 简单的字符串处理题。 - **1021**: 找规律的数学题。 - **1026**: 搜索题,具体细节未知。 - **1028**: 整数拆分问题,使用母函数求解。 - **1029**: 简单题,一般方法容易超时。 - **1030**: 简单题,可用模拟求解。 - **1031**: 简单题,具体细节未知。 - **1032**: 简单题,具体细节未知。 - **1042**: 大数题,具体细节未知。 - **1046**: 简单题,具体细节未知。 - **1048**: 简单字符串处理题。 - **1049**: 简单题,具体细节未知。 - **1050**: 贪心算法题。 - **1057**: 丑数的经典问题,使用DP求解。 - **1062**: 简单字符串处理题。 - **1063**: 模拟大数处理题。 - **1064**: 简单题,具体细节未知。 - **1065**: 简单题,具体细节未知。 - **1066**: 数学题,找规律题。 - **1070**: 简单题,具体细节未知。 - **1073**: 字符串处理题,具体细节未知。 - **1076**: 简单题,具体细节未知。 - **1082**: 简单题,具体细节未知。 - **1084**: 简单题,具体细节未知。 - **1090~1096**: 输入输出练习题,具体细节未知。 - **1107**: 简单题,具体细节未知。 - **1113**: 简单题,具体细节未知。 - **1117**: 简单题,具体细节未知。 - **1119**: 简单题,具体细节未知。 - **1128**: 简单题,具体细节未知。 - **1129**: 简单题,具体细节未知。 - **1144**: 简单题,具体细节未知。 - **1148**: 简单题,具体细节未知。 - **1157**: 简单题,具体细节未知。 - **1161**: 简单题,具体细节未知。 - **1170**: 简单题,具体细节未知。 - **1172**: 简单题,具体细节未知。 - **1177**: 简单题,具体细节未知。 - **1197**: 简单题,具体细节未知。 - **1200**: 大数取模问题,具体细节未知。 - **1201**: 简单题,具体细节未知。 - **1202**: 简单题,具体细节未知。 - **1205**: 简单题,具体细节未知。 - **1209**: 简单题,具体细节未知。 - **1212**: 大数取模问题,具体细节未知。 - **1218**: 数据结构题,具体细节未知。 - **1219**: 数据结构题,具体细节未知。 - **1225**: 数据结构题,具体细节未知。 - **1228**: 数据结构题,具体细节未知。 - **1229**: 数据结构题,具体细节未知。 - **1230**: 数据结构题,具体细节未知。 - **1234**: 数据结构题,具体细节未知。 - **1235**: 数据结构题,具体细节未知。 - **1236**: 数据结构题,具体细节未知。 - **1237**: 数据结构题,具体细节未知。 - **1239**: 数据结构题,具体细节未知。 - **1250**: 数据结构题,具体细节未知。 - **1256**: 简单题,具体细节未知。 - **1259**: 简单题,具体细节未知。 - **1262**: 简单题,具体细节未知。 - **1263**: 简单题,具体细节未知。 - **1265**: 简单题,具体细节未知。 - **1266**: 简单题,具体细节未知。 - **1276**: 简单题,具体细节未知。 - **1279**: 简单题,具体细节未知。 - **1282**: 简单题,具体细节未知。 - **1283**: 简单题,具体细节未知。 - **1287**: 简单题,具体细节未知。 - **1296**: 简单题,具体细节未知。 - **1302**: 简单题,具体细节未知。 - **1303**: 简单题,具体细节未知。 - **1304**: 简单题,具体细节未知。 - **1305**: 简单题,具体细节未知。 - **1306**: 简单题,具体细节未知。 - **1309**: 简单题,具体细节未知。 - **1311**: 简单题,具体细节未知。 - **1314**: 简单题,具体细节未知。 通过上述分类,我们可以看出ACM竞赛涵盖了广泛的计算机科学领域,包括但不限于大数处理、动态规划、贪心算法、搜索技术、数据结构、数学等。这些分类为参赛者提供了清晰的学习路径和练习方向,帮助他们更好地准备比赛。










剩余7页未读,继续阅读


- 粉丝: 0
我的内容管理 展开
我的资源 快来上传第一个资源
我的收益
登录查看自己的收益我的积分 登录查看自己的积分
我的C币 登录后查看C币余额
我的收藏
我的下载
下载帮助


最新资源
- 基于单片机的交流电机转动控制系统方案设计书.doc
- 《项目管理决策分析与评价》摸底评测.doc
- 综合布线设计方案.docx
- 区块链技术在金融领域应用的风险管理策略研究.docx
- 数据库应用技术知识点.doc
- ATS单片机停车场车位设计.doc
- 2018年度四川省大数据时代的互联网信息安全试题及答案1.doc
- 数据库设计报告1111111111111.doc
- 项目管理在农用飞机维修工程中的应用.docx
- 基于物联网的智能家居系统的设计与应用.docx
- kubernetes系列03—kubeadm安装部署K8S集群.docx
- 基于服务器虚拟化的政务云平台设计.docx
- C语言程序设计工业和信息化普通高等教育“十二五”规划教材立项项目-赵山林-高媛.doc
- matlab电炉温度控制算法比较及仿真研究分析.doc
- 电力调度自动化系统的网络安全问题与对策分析.docx
- 大数据时代人力资源管理创新策略初探.docx


